Unitaid is celebrating its 20th anniversary this year. For two decades, the organization has worked at the intersection of health innovation and large-scale impact, using catalytic investments, market shaping, and strategic partnerships to speed up access to lifesaving health products around the world.

Over these 20 years, Unitaid has helped bring more than 150 health innovations and products to scale, benefiting approximately 390 million people every year across more than 100 countries. Independent analysis commissioned by Unitaid found that every US$1 invested yields US$46 in return. From more affordable HIV treatment to new tools for hepatitis C and drug-resistant TB, Unitaid’s model of catalytic investment and market shaping has transformed access to lifesaving health products worldwide.

To mark the milestone, Unitaid has released a new anniversary report, From Innovation to Impact, reflecting on two decades of investment and the lessons learned along the way. The report is available at https://20years.unitaid.org/.

Ukraine is among the countries benefiting from this work. With Unitaid’s support, the Alliance for Public Health is expanding access to long-acting injectable (depot) buprenorphine for opioid dependence treatment, alongside low-threshold hepatitis C testing and treatment services designed for communities most affected by the epidemic, including people who inject drugs.
